Spartanburg County, SC – Former Arkansas Governor Mike

Huckabee beat out Republican competition Saturday by more than 400 points at the Spartanburg County convention, reflecting growing momentum for his possible 2008 White House bid in South Carolina. Huckabee pulled in 3522 points, followed by Rudy Guiliani with 3161.

Huckabee also came in second place in a straw poll in Greenville County with 111 votes. Mitt Romney placed first with 132.
